Super Car Traffic Race Big Monster Apps
0+ (All)
Screenshots
Description
Here come the awesome traffic game of 2015 Super car traffic race.
You might also like
Truck Driver 3DKiwi Games Studio
Bus Simulator 3DKiwi Games Studio
Adrenaline RaceMad Scientist Games